Tu sais ce que je trouve intéressant dans le fonctionnement de la blockchain ? La plupart des gens se concentrent sur les récompenses de minage, mais ils manquent complètement pourquoi le nonce est un mécanisme si ingénieux derrière tout ça.



Voici le truc : nonce signifie « numéro utilisé une seule fois », et c’est essentiellement un nombre aléatoire qui est ajouté à vos données de transaction avant d’être haché. Ça paraît simple, mais c’est en réalité genius. Sans lui, tout le processus de minage serait cassé.

Laissez-moi vous expliquer pourquoi c’est important. Lorsqu’un mineur travaille sur un block, il prend les données de transaction et modifie continuellement la valeur du nonce jusqu’à ce qu’il trouve un qui produit un hash correspondant à la difficulté cible du réseau. C’est comme une loterie, sauf que les règles sont mathématiques. La fonction de hachage SHA-256 convertit toutes ces données en une valeur unique, et si elle atteint la cible, boum—le block est ajouté à la blockchain.

Ce qui m’a vraiment bluffé quand j’ai compris ça, c’est que le nonce empêche les mineurs de tricher. Sans lui, tu pourrais simplement soumettre la même transaction encore et encore pour réclamer plusieurs récompenses. L’élément aléatoire que le nonce introduit signifie que chaque block doit être vraiment unique. C’est comme ça que le réseau reste sécurisé.

Le mécanisme de consensus proof-of-work repose essentiellement sur tout ce système. Les mineurs rivalisent pour trouver des valeurs de hash valides, et le premier qui y parvient reçoit la récompense. Le nonce garantit l’équité—tu ne peux pas simplement forcer ton chemin en répétant ce qui a marché avant. Chaque tentative demande un vrai travail computationnel.

Ce qui est aussi important, c’est la façon dont la difficulté de minage est liée à tout ça. Le réseau ajuste périodiquement la valeur cible, ce qui signifie qu’à mesure que plus de mineurs rejoignent ou que le matériel devient plus rapide, la difficulté augmente. Plus d’itérations de nonce sont nécessaires pour trouver un hash valide. C’est un système auto-équilibrant qui maintient le temps de création de block relativement constant.

Imaginez : si les réseaux blockchain supprimaient le nonce, tout le modèle de sécurité s’effondrerait. Les mineurs pourraient manipuler les transactions, double-spender ou simplement spammer le réseau avec des blocks sans valeur. Le nonce, c’est ce qui fait que la preuve de travail fonctionne réellement. C’est l’une de ces solutions élégantes qui paraissent évidentes une fois qu’on la comprend, mais qui sont fondamentales pour le fonctionnement de tout le système.

Si vous vous lancez dans la crypto ou si vous essayez simplement de comprendre comment ces réseaux restent sécurisés, saisir le concept de nonce est essentiel. Ce n’est pas juste un détail technique—c’est au cœur de la fiabilité de la technologie blockchain.
Voir l'original
Cette page peut inclure du contenu de tiers fourni à des fins d'information uniquement. Gate ne garantit ni l'exactitude ni la validité de ces contenus, n’endosse pas les opinions exprimées, et ne fournit aucun conseil financier ou professionnel à travers ces informations. Voir la section Avertissement pour plus de détails.
  • Récompense
  • Commentaire
  • Reposter
  • Partager
Commentaire
Ajouter un commentaire
Ajouter un commentaire
Aucun commentaire
  • Épingler